I have chipmunks I'm dealing with who are destructive and purchased these as well as the LARGE RAT sized ones to deal with the Pack Rats on the Mountain where we are building a cabin. I have 8 of these set but have only caught 1 mouse and 1 chipmunk. The bait is being taken on ALL of them but only 2 out of 8 have gone off and caught anything in the 2 weeks I've had them. I put fresh bait consisting of peanut butter with a little chopped up nuts on top and they love it because the traps are licked clean. If I barely touch the trap to see if it's defective and not going off, it goes off and scares the life out of me but for some reason or somehow they aren't going off very often with the mice and chippers. Maybe I'll try some cheese but I fear that will dry out and not entice anything. Perhaps they are going up the backside of the trap after it's set and not touching the pad at the front thus causing it not to grab em!!!

There are 2 basic types of snap traps [1] bait-triggered and [2] platform around the bait-triggered. The old fashioned model had a wooden base with a clip to attach a piece of bread or cheese; the trip-wire was balanced under the clip with bait so when that moved the spring would be released and the snap would travel 180 degrees for the rodential interaction. It was messy because you had to handle the same snap-wire that killed the rodent to release the rodent and reset the spring, and it was risky because it was difficult to hook on some bait and cock the spring without risking your own fingers. Enter the new and "improved" snap trap - cleanable plastic, two wires, 1 for setting/releasing and 1 for snapping, 90 degree traverse was less risk to fingers. The difference is the bait is in a stationary compartment in the center of a little plate or platform, onto which the beast supposedly steps to get to the bait. The old kind - the bait plate sprang the trap - the newer kind - the platform around the bait springs the trap. In my experience, both types of traps can be robbed, but with the stationary bait trap, they have stolen the peanut butter every time.
